This informative book introduces young readers to the human body's digestive system with a focus on vomiting. Written for early readers aged 5-8, it uses simple language and relatable scenarios to explain why vomiting occurs. The book includes fact boxes, a body map, and additional resources to support learning, making it a helpful educational tool for parents and children.
